What Inadequate means for your family
An Inadequate rating is the CQC’s strongest public signal. The service is placed in special measures, the provider is told exactly what must change, and inspectors return within six months. If it has not improved by then, the CQC can cancel its registration.
That does not always mean people were harmed. Read the report: some Inadequate ratings follow a serious incident, others follow a long slide in records, staffing and leadership. Our explanation on each service page lists the specific breaches and the enforcement taken, with the inspectors’ own words.
If a relative is already there, ask the manager what the improvement plan says and when the next inspection is due. If you are choosing, it is reasonable to wait for the re-inspection.
